MACRO Roma Unveils Summer 2021 Program with 'Exhibition Magazine' Format

exhibition · 2026-04-27

MACRO Roma's summer 2021 initiative continues the 'exhibition magazine' concept introduced in 2020. According to Director Luca Lo Pinto, several sections commenced in February, marking an active period. Cultural assessor Lorenza Fruci referred to it as an 'identity flow.' Notable events include 'Musica da Camera' (June 10–August 29) featuring Franca Sacchi, 'Studio Bibliografico' (June 15–September 5) showcasing works by Noah Barker, Éric Baudelaire, and Walid Raad, and 'Polifonia' (June 22–October 10) spotlighting Friedl Kubelka vom Gröller. Julie Peeters heads 'In-Design' (July 8–October 24), while Tony Cokes' 'Solo/Multi' launches on July 15. The 'Retrofuturo' section highlights emerging artists starting July 13. A documentary on Lawrence Weiner debuts June 30, with performances on July 1 and Darren Bader's AR exhibition available until July 31. The 'AGORÀ' series resumes on July 16.
